This winter we will be exploring what it means to truly belong…how to stay connected to ourselves and others in a divided, lonely and polarized world. We will discover how true belonging doesn’t require us to change who we are. It requires us to be who we are. 

Social scientist Brene Brown, PhD, has sparked a global conversation about the experiences that bring meaning to our lives - experiences of courage, vulnerability, love, belonging, shame and empathy. In this book-study we will explore these topics and learn how to engage in compassionate dialogue with others in an age of extreme polarization.
